sql >> Databáze >  >> RDS >> PostgreSQL

PG::UndefinedTable:ERROR:vztah neexistuje se správným pojmenováním a konvencí Rails

Mám stejný problém a zjistil jsem, že při migracích nemám názvy tabulek v množném čísle:

Například:



    class CreatePosts  ActiveRecord::Migration
      def change
        create_table :posts do |t|
          t.string :source
          t.string :destination
          t.datetime :time
          t.timestamps
        end
      end
    end


Mám create_table :post , ale když to změním na create_table :posts .Začíná to fungovat!!!!



  1. Jak mít dynamické SQL v MySQL uložené procedury

  2. Jak zahrnout celkový počet vrácených řádků do sady výsledků z příkazu SELECT T-SQL?

  3. Jak funguje funkce QUOTENAME() v SQL Server (T-SQL)

  4. Jak vyřešit chybějící výraz ORA-00936